The text related to the cultural heritage 'Jelling Mounds, Runic Stones and Church' has mentioned 'Buffer zone' in the following places:

Under the same statue, the church is surrounded by a buffer zone of 300m. | UNESCO |
This prohibits any activities that may damage or disturb the monuments, and provides for a buffer zone of 2m around the monument. | UNESCO |
The Protection of Nature Act provides an additional buffer zone of 100m around the 2m buffer zone. | UNESCO |
This plan emphasizes the need for moving the present road away from the monument, and for demolishing a number of neighbouring houses in order to establish a proper buffer zone to contain the area surrounded by the palisade. | UNESCO |
An extension of the buffer zone, to strengthen the relationship between the property and its setting, is being planned and this will decisively contribute to the integrated value of the whole monument and its environment. | UNESCO |
A road near the southern mound will be removed in accordance with the planned buffer zone extension. | UNESCO |
